Germanys Federal Financial Supervisory Authority (BaFin) has published a new report revealing that over half of retail investors struggle to understand structured investment products, particularly complex instruments like express certificates. While the findings focus on traditional financial products, they raise broader concerns that also resonate within the forex industry.
The review, conducted between May 2024 and February 2025, came in response to a surge in certificate sales after the end of the low interest rate era. For the first time, BaFin combined regulatory inspections with consumer surveys and mystery shopping visits to assess how products are designed, marketed, and understood.
While most institutions met basic regulatory obligations, BaFin flagged multiple deficiencies—including vague cost structures, insufficient risk modeling, and weak safeguards against sales-driven conflicts of interest.

BaFin found that many issuers failed to properly account for early product maturity risk. In cases where the underlying asset price rises rapidly, clients are forced to reinvest at potentially less favorable terms. This critical risk was not clearly explained to customers during the sales process.
The report also noted discrepancies in how distribution fees are disclosed—some banks classify them as service charges, while others fold them into the product price. Such inconsistency, though technically legal, can hinder customers ability to make informed comparisons across financial products.

BaFin says it will follow up with firms where deficiencies were identified and may expand oversight to include more institutions. The regulators focus appears to be shifting from reactive enforcement to proactive supervision of product development and sales practices.
